Suzuki GSX-R. Front fork components



  1. Front fork cap
  2. O-ring
  3. Rebound damping force adjuster rod
  4. Compression damping force adjuster rod
  5. Piston rod nut
  6. O-ring
  7. Piston ring
  8. Rod guide case
  9. Spring
  10. Piston rod
  11. Spring collar b
  12. Spring
  13. Spring collar a
  14. Slide bushing
  15. Outer tube
  16. Guide bushing
  17. Oil seal spacer
  18. Oil seal
  19. Stopper ring
  20. Dust seal
  21. Inner tube
  22. Front axle pinch bolt
  23. 35
    N·m (3.5 Kgf-m, 25.5 Lbf-ft)
  24. 28 N·m
    (2.8 Kgf-m, 20.0 Lbf-ft)
  25. 90 N·m
    (9.0 Kgf-m, 65.0 Lbf-ft)
  26. 23 N·m
    (2.3 Kgf-m, 16.5 Lbf-ft)

Apply fork oil.


Do not reuse.
